International Activity Patch

Who can earn the International Activity Patch: Anyone who is a registered Scout or Adult Leader, which includes Boy Scouts, Cub Scouts, Girl Scouts, Venture Scouts, or Varsity Scouts can earn the badge.

The International Relations Committee requires that at least four out of these twelve criteria be completed before the insignia is worn:

1. Host a group of foreign students at a dinner, meeting or campout weekend, and plan activities to help you learn about their countries.

2. Plan and execute an international dinner, inviting foreign Scouts as guests or serving an ethnic meal.

3. Participate in an International Scout Jamboree or Camporee.

4. Host a group of Scouts on tour in your area.

5. Visit a local Scout group while your Scout group is touring another country.

6. Participate in Jamboree-on-the-Air.

7. Experience the World Friendship Fund campfire program with your unit.

8. Visit a foreign embassy or consulate and learn about its function.

9. Earn the Interpreter Strip.

10. Earn or Instruct the Citizenship in the World Merit Badge or the equivalent through Girl Scouts.

11. Participate in an International theme program at a unit meeting- display international badges, pins, stamps, etc

12. Collect information about Scouting in another country and make a presentation at a Unit meeting.
